Our 2023 rankings named Herzing University - Madison the most popular online school in Wisconsin for health professions students working on their undergraduate certificate. Located in the large city of Madison, Herzing University - Madison is a private not-for-profit school with a small student population.
Women make up 95% of the health professions majors at the school.

Out of the 10 online programs at schools in Wisconsin that were part of this year’s ranking, Herzing University - Brookfield landed the # 2 spot on the list. Herzing University - Brookfield is a small private not-for-profit school located in the suburb of Brookfield.
Women make up 97% of the health professions majors at the school.

The in-demand online undergraduate certificate programs at Southwest Wisconsin Technical College helped the school earn the #3 place on this year’s ranking of the best health professions schools in Wisconsin. Southwest Tech is a small public school located in the rural area of Fennimore.
Women make up 98% of the health professions majors at the school.

The in-demand online undergraduate certificate programs at Moraine Park Technical College helped the school earn the #4 place on this year’s ranking of the best health professions schools in Wisconsin. Moraine Park Technical College is a small public school located in the small city of Fond du Lac.
Of the 82 students majoring in health professions at Moraine Park Technical College, 9% are male and 91% are female.

Out of the 10 online programs at schools in Wisconsin that were part of this year’s ranking, Northcentral Technical College landed the # 5 spot on the list. North Central Technical College is a moderately-sized public school located in the small city of Wausau.
Of the 62 students majoring in health professions at North Central Technical College, 16% are male and 84% are female.

Madison Area Technical College ranked #6 on this year’s Most Popular Online Health Professions Undergraduate Certificate Schools in Wisconsin list. Located in the large city of Madison, Madison College is a public school with a large student population.
About 77% of the students majoring in health professions at the school are women while 23% are male.

Mid-State Technical College came in at #7 in this year’s edition of the Most Popular Online Health Professions Undergraduate Certificate Schools in Wisconsin ranking. Located in the rural area of Wisconsin Rapids, Mid-State is a public school with a small student population.
Of the 68 students majoring in health professions at Mid-State, 10% are male and 90% are female.

Northeast Wisconsin Technical College landed the #8 spot in the 2023 rankings for the most popular online undergraduate certificate health professions programs. NWTC is a fairly large public school located in the medium-sized city of Green Bay.
Of the 332 students majoring in health professions at NWTC, 11% are male and 89% are female.

Herzing University - Kenosha came in at #9 in this year’s edition of the Most Popular Online Health Professions Undergraduate Certificate Schools in Wisconsin ranking. Located in the suburb of Kenosha, Herzing University - Kenosha is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.
About 92% of the students majoring in health professions at the school are women while 8% are male.
